The primary problems these services help solve include structural damage, water intrusion, and debris removal. Tornadoes often cause significant destruction to roofs, walls, windows, and foundations, creating safety risks and exposing interiors to the elements. Restoration specialists work to stabilize the property by boarding up openings, tarping damaged roofs, and removing hazardous debris. They also address water damage caused by rain or broken plumbing, which can lead to mold growth and further deterioration if not promptly managed. This comprehensive approach helps mitigate secondary problems and prepares the property for subsequent repairs.

The overview below groups typical Tornado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Peoria,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Water Damage Restoration Costs - Typically, water damage repair services range from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the extent of flooding and affected areas. For example, a small basement may cost around $1,200, while larger repairs can reach $4,000 or more.
Mold Remediation Expenses - Mold removal services generally cost between $500 and $6,000, with average projects around $2,000. Costs vary based on the size of the affected space and the severity of mold growth.
Structural Damage Repair Costs - Restoring structural damage from tornadoes can range from $3,000 to $15,000 or higher. Minor repairs may be closer to $3,000, while extensive rebuilding can exceed $15,000.
Debris Removal Services - Clearing storm debris typically costs between $300 and $1,500, depending on the volume and type of debris. Larger or more complex cleanup projects t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
